Trying to open a document in SOP and you get told the following? Your previous transaction-level posting session has not finished processing. Please allow time for it to finish. Second most asked question in support…this occurs when posting routines were interrupted for some reason.

  1. Back up your Dynamics and company databases.
  2. Note down the GP user ID of the session that is getting the error message. Then get everyone out of GP.
  3. Go to MSSQL and open a new query window. Run the following query: Delete dynamics..sy00800
  4. Run the following queries against the Company database
  5. SELECT * from SY00500 where BACHNUMB = ”
  6. If this query returns any rows, then run: Delete SY00500 where bachnumb = ”
  7. SELECT * from SY00500 where BACHNUMB = ‘???’ (where ??? is the USER ID of the person getting the problem in GP)
  8. If this query returns rows, then run: Delete SY00500 where bachnumb = ‘???’